Ingredients
- 3 medium ripe bananas (mashed)
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ter (softened)
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1 cup chopped walnuts (lightly toasted)
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×13-inch baking pan.
- In a mixing b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th.
- In another bowl, cream the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add mashed bananas, eggs, and vanilla; mix well.
- Whisk together the flour and baking powder in a separate bowl; gradually combine with the wet mixture without overmixing.
- Gently fold in the chopped walnuts.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for 30-35 minutes or until golden brown. Allow cooling before frosting.
